JEAN MCVEY, Obituary

By HDN Staff

GREAT FALLS Jean McVey, 86, died Friday, July 13, 2001 from lung cancer.

Her ashes were interred in Missoula with a grandson's ashes.

A memorial service was held Sunday afternoon at Schnider Funeral Home Fellowship Hall in Great Falls.

McVey was born June 25, 1915 in Great Falls to Elizabeth Olsen. She spent her childhood on a homestead 12 miles north of Havre and attended schools north of Havre and in North Dakota and Illinois.

She married Rowatt Callagahan in Chinook. They later divorced.

She married Ray Cullen. When that marriage ended in divorce, she married Ray McVey.

McVey was proud of her Norwegian heritage and loved homemade things and old-fashioned ways. She was known to take in stray people and animals and was a mentor to many.

McVey was preceded in death by her husband, Ray McVey, in 1957; sister, Helen Vanberg; brothers, Vern Bennett and Robert Perry; grandson, Vern Baker.

Survivors include her sons, Joe Callagahan of Phillipsburg, Glenn Callagahan of Longview, Wash., Ron McVey of Great Falls, Mark McVey of Clinton, Max McVey of Missoula; daughters, Marilyn Smith of Spokane, Wash., Connie Wellington of Great Falls, and Vicki Williams of Honca Path, S.C.
